Technical Writer - Altrincham, United Kingdom - Siemens
Description
We are Siemens
Siemens EDA is a global technology leader in electronic design automation software. Our software tools enable companies around the world to develop new and highly innovative electronic products faster and more cost-effectively. Our customers use our tools to push the boundaries of technology and physics in order to deliver better products in the increasingly complex world of chip, board and system design.
What we're looking for
Are you an innovative, collaborative and technically adept writer or engineer? Do you wish to utilise your technical background to maximum effect by developing real-world examples, tutorials, and multimedia content that assists customers in using Siemens products to accomplish goals.
We're seeking a
Technical Writer to join our cutting-edge team developing complex Electrical and Electronic systems-design tools for the automotive, aerospace, and adjacent industries.
What you'll be doing
- Working with the latest cuttingedge technology in Vehicle Networking
- Developing taskbased content that teaches customers how to get the most out of their embedded tools
- Taking a proactive role in working with the product team to research and identify use cases
- Collaborating with geographicallydispersed colleagues on crossfunctional teams
What you'll bring
- Electrical Engineering, Computer Science, or a related degree
- Technical writing experience, supporting complex technical products
- Familiarity with vehicle network architectures, ECU communications/design and Eclipsebased IDEs, or similar
- Ability to come up to speed quickly on a new project and balance multiple tasks and competing priorities
- Knowledge of task analysis and topicbased structured (DITA XML) authoring
- Excellent communications the ability to write clearly and accurately in English is essential
